Nitrate Vulnerable Zones

Volume 502: debated on Monday 7 December 2009

To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s how many farms there are in nitrate vulnerable zones in each region of England; and what the (a) size and (b) location is of each such farm. (303451)

The partial impact assessment accompanying the August 2007 consultation on the implementation of the nitrates directive in England estimated the number of farms in the NVZ in each region of the UK on the basis of the 2005 agricultural census.

Number

North East

1,078

North West

15,144

Yorkshire and the Humber

14,980

East Midlands

20,431

West Midlands

20,350

Eastern

22,777

South East

20,328

South West

24,514

Total

139,601

Details of the size and location of each farm could be provided only at disproportionate cost.
